The Role

Job Description:

Job Summary
As the HR and Reward Advisor you will hold a pivotal role with real influence and visibility across the business. In this high-impact reward role, your main responsibilities will include the provision of HR solutions and tools and expertise in compliance with the appropriate HR Reward policies and processes. You will ensure the maintenance and management of all benefits and collective remuneration processes on the site and this will, at times, involve supporting the national reward team.

 

HOW YOU WILL CONTRIBUTE TO THE TEAM  

  • You will be the key focal point for reward queries from employees and managers, ensuring response within a timely manner and escalating as necessary

  • Directly responsible for the operational delivery of compensation and benefit deliverables, new initiatives and data-driven recommendations

  • You will manage invoice and purchase order processing, completing checks to ensure accuracy and processing within the agreed timescales. Liaising with Finance, Payroll, Accounts Payable, Procurement and external suppliers as appropriate

  • Dealing with sensitive data with a high level of discretion (eg salary information, medical etc)

  • Champion HR and Reward operational accountabilities and represent the team with internal and external stakeholders

  • Budget management and input into annual operational budget planning

  • Ongoing ad hoc support to the wider Reward team

Employee Benefits

  • You will establish a comprehensive understanding of employee benefit arrangements to support the transition and ongoing business as usual. This will include liaising with suppliers to ensure a smooth process, including annual renewals and ensuring the correct eligibility is applied relevant to the contracts

  • You will need to have regular communications with the Reward Operations team to provide monthly benefit choices/deductions and benefit in kind reporting

Pay Review & Benchmarking

  • You will complete annual Benchmarking activities, reviewing external market rates to support the annual pay and bonus cycles

  • Lead on all pay and reward cycles 

  • Data analysis, reporting and the communication of insights

  • Ad-hoc query resolution to support the business, employee engagement, retention and new hires

  • Focal point for all reward queries and support on cross-functional projects

Job Evaluation

  • Provide expert advice on job evaluation and pay benchmarking to include the presentation of recommendations to senior leaders and HRBPs 

  • You will use evaluation tools in order to review and establish the correct grading of roles as required by request from Managers or HRBP or as part of the recruitment process

Relocation

  • You will be the focal point for any relocation queries to include data collation and liaising with the recruitment and HR teams

Long Service/Recognition

  • You will review and manage long service and recognition events for employees and ensure the smooth running of the recognition and award processes

  • Management of the awards and recognition portal

ABOUT YOU

  • 5+ years experience in a similar role within Human Resources with knowledge of reward, compensation and benefits management

  • Experience of working within faced-paced, customer-facing environments

  • The ability to interpret data, spot trends and provide creative solutions

  • Confident in presenting to and influencing stakeholders

  • Project management and strong problem solving skills - liaising with Payroll and Suppliers as well as the wider UK Reward Team

  • Experience working with external suppliers as well as internally liaising cross-divisionally

  • Experience comparing reports/data with strong attention to detail and focus on data quality

  • High energy with the ability to work fully autonomously 

  • Query response management and ability to problem solve

  • Experience liaising with employees and managers - for example, ability to create and share appropriate communication pieces, utilising suitable channels

What We Do

Airbus is a global leader in aeronautics, space and related services. In 2020, it generated revenues of €49.9 billion and employed a workforce of around 130,000. Airbus offers the most comprehensive range of passenger airliners. Airbus is also a European leader providing tanker, combat, transport and mission aircraft, as well as one of the world’s leading space companies. In helicopters, Airbus provides the most efficient civil and military rotorcraft solutions worldwide.

Airbus is an international pioneer in the aerospace industry and a leader in designing, manufacturing and delivering aerospace products, services and solutions to customers on a global scale.
